Book SynopsisFor all its good intentions, Who Moved My Cheese? basically reduces us to mice in a maze sniffing after cheese. Donât ask why youâre in a maze, donât ask what makes the cheese move, just keep your head down and find it. And yet, success in areas such as innovation, entrepreneurship, creativity, problem solving, and business growth often depends on the ability to challenge assumptions, reshape the environment, and play by a different set of rules (your own!).Harvard Business School professor Deepak Malhorta uses a fable involving a different set of mice in a mazeâmice who question everythingâto help readers see how they underestimate their ability change the rules, overcome the constraints they face, and control their own destiny. Malhotra encourages readers to audit their assumptions about what limitations they really face and which are self-imposed or unthinkingly accepted. We can create the circumstances and realities we want âwe can go beyond simply changing our behavior (find that new cheese!) to changing the game itself. But to do so we need to understand the ways weâre holding ourselves back. As one of the characters in the book says, âœthe problem is not that the mouse is in the maze, but that the maze is in the mouse.â

Book SynopsisCreativity is crucial to business success. But too often, even the most innovative organization quickly becomes a giant hairball--a tangled, impenetrable mass of rules, traditions, and systems, all based on what worked in the past--that exercises an inexorable pull into mediocrity. Gordon McKenzie worked at Hallmark Cards for thirty years, many of which he spent inspiring his colleagues to slip the bonds of Corporate Normalcy and rise to orbit--to a mode of dreaming, daring and doing above and beyond the rubber-stamp confines of the administrative mind-set. In his deeply funny book, exuberantly illustrated in full color, he shares the story of his own professional evolution, together with lessons on awakening and fostering creative genius.Originally self-published and already a business cult classic, this personally empowering and entertaining look at the intersection between human creativity and the bottom line is now widely available to bookstores. Book SynopsisMost of us know there is a payoff to looking good, and in the quest for beauty we spend countless hours and billions of dollars on personal grooming, cosmetics, and plastic surgery. But how much better off are the better looking? Based on the evidence, quite a lot. The first book to seriously measure the advantages of beauty, Beauty Pays demonstratTrade Review"Since the mid-nineties, Daniel Hamermesh ... has done a series of studies on the role that appearance plays in the workplace, and his conclusion is captured by the title of his recent book, Beauty Pays. In the U.S., he finds, better-looking men earn four per cent more than average-looking men of similar education and experience, and uglier men earn thirteen per cent less... Hamermesh finds that pulchritude is valuable in nearly all professions, not just those where good looks may seem to be an obvious asset."--Jim Surowiecki, New Yorker "This chatty, economist's-eye-view of beauty in the marketplace provides solid statistical evidence that beauty does pay."--Publishers Weekly "An extensive, dizzying compilation of economic data explaining 'why attractive people are more successful.' A 40-year veteran in the field of economics, Hamermesh examines the correlation between beauty and economics... Fascinating."--Kirkus Reviews "[A] no-warts-and-all expose of how attractive people earn more, marry better and enjoy a wealth of positive discrimination."--Anjana Ahuja, Prospect "Daniel Hamermesh ... has long written about 'pulchronomics.' In Beauty Pays he reckons that, over a lifetime and assuming today's mean wages, a handsome working in America might on average make $230,000 more than a very plain one. There is evidence that attractive workers bring in more business, so it often makes sense for firms to hire them.
